A.M. Broomfield's research focuses on the integration and field testing of cybersecurity solutions for photovoltaic systems. Their work addresses the security vulnerabilities inherent in modern energy infrastructure. Broomfield has published on the integration and field testing of a multilevel cybersecurity solution specifically designed for photovoltaic systems. This research contributes to the growing body of work on securing renewable energy technologies against potential cyber threats.
Broomfield's scholarly output includes 19 publications with a total of 17 citations and an h-index of 3. They have collaborated with several faculty members at the University of Arkansas at Fayetteville, including Kenneth Mordi, Chris Farnell, Wesley G. Schwartz, and Anna Corbitt, on shared publications, indicating an active research network within the institution.
